Output 09b873d102c1f27adf4c58f9a18deaa916405351423a0e71247895d517465ed3:1

value
140652906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53b8a96cb3674d6f20daabd1321e58b6f7a57a8f OP_EQUAL
address
MFXqXszPedY4czd6yiNQxrLdTkFZ2MnJ5L
transaction
09b873d102c1f27adf4c58f9a18deaa916405351423a0e71247895d517465ed3
spent
true